There has been no response from Irish Water or the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) to questions from Castlebar Municipal District management over the cause of an odour that sometimes emanates from the Waste Water Treatment Plant located on the Turlough Road in Castlebar.

That was confirmed to Fine Gael councillor Ger Deere by management at the monthly meeting of the District.

The councillor has been raising the issue at District level for months now.

However, Independent cllr Harry Barrett said that he had recently been informed by the EPA that a major issue with the heating system at the plant had occurred and was resolved in February of this year, suggesting that the odour issue is now resolved.

But cllr Deere is not convinved as he says the odour has been a problem since last summer. The cllr told Midwest News Editor Teresa O’Malley he will continue to seek direct answers on the matter from council management:
